§ 377.61

Added by Stats. 1992, Ch. 178, Sec. 20. Effective January 1, 1993.

In an action under this article, damages may be awarded that, under all the circumstances of the case, may be just, but may not include damages recoverable under Section 377.34. The court shall determine the respective rights in an award of the persons entitled to assert the cause of action.
